The Jerry Baker Memorial Velodrome needs volunteers! We are seeking community members that have an interest in broadcasting, live streaming hardware and software, and/or sports coverage.

Many of you are aware that we started live streaming racing last season. The MVA leadership is hoping to expand our reach by offering more consistent, high-quality live streaming services over Facebook Live and YouTube, and we need volunteers to help make this happen.

All volunteers will be trained on the how to use the equipment and software. No previous experience is required!

Summary of duties/responsibilities of volunteer:

· Weekly attendance at Friday Night Racing, every Friday night from roughly 6:15 PM to 10:30, with weekly races May 24th August 30th

· Assisting with hardware setup (monitor and peripherals moved to location, connective cables for broadcast prepared)

· Preparing scenes for broadcast with name of each race for the night, including any other important information for viewers

· Prepping and changing scenes for the duration of the event (estimated 7:00 PM – 10:30 PM), including switching between cameras for different view points

· Monitoring stream, writing responses to questions/comments, ensuring quality for viewers

· Assisting with breakdown of all materials (10:30 PM)

· Attendance at extra events would also be great – special events May 17-18, May 24-25, June 22, July 19-20 and August 16-17

We know this is a significant time commitment! Even partial assistance/volunteering would make such a difference for our community. If you have any questions, please do not hesitate to contact webadm@velodrome.org.
